silvanus
IPA: sˈɪɫvʌnɪs
Root Word: Silvanus
noun
- (Roman mythology) A god of forests.
- (biblical) A companion of Paul, also called Silas.
- A male given name from Latin, more often spelled Sylvanus, but never popular in either form.
